Lets compare vitamin content per 7 ounces of Frozen Broccoli Spears vs Cottonseed Oil:
- 7 ounces of Frozen Broccoli Spears have more Vitamin A, more Vitamin B1, more Vitamin B2, more Vitamin B3, more Vitamin B5, more Vitamin B6, more Vitamin B9, more Vitamin C and 4.1 times more Vitamin K than Cottonseed Oil.
- While 7 oz of Salad or Cooking Cottonseed Oil contain 26.1 times more Vitamin E than Frozen Broccoli Spears.
- 7 ounces of Cottonseed Oil have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B1,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B5,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B9 and Vitamin C
- Both Frozen Broccoli Spears as well as Salad or Cooking Cottonseed Oil have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in seven ounces.
Comparing minerals per 7 ounces for Frozen Broccoli Spears vs Cottonseed Oil:
- 7 ounces of Frozen Broccoli Spears have more Calcium, more Copper, more Iron, more Magnesium, more Phosphorus, more Potassium, more Selenium, more Zinc and more Water than Cottonseed Oil.
- 7 ounces of Cottonseed Oil l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Copper, Iron, Magnesium, Phosphorus, Potassium, Selenium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 7 ounces:
- 7 ounces of Frozen Broccoli Spears have more Carbohydrate, more Sugars, more Fiber and more Protein than Cottonseed Oil.
- While 7 oz of Salad or Cooking Cottonseed Oil contain 30.5 times more Energy, 294.1 times more Fat, 498.1 times more Saturated Fat, 1.6 times more Omega 3 and 1391.9 times more Omega 6 than Frozen Broccoli Spears.
- 7 ounces of Frozen Broccoli Spears provide inadequate amounts of Energy and Omega 6
- 7 ounces of Cottonseed Oil provide inadequate amounts of Carbohydrate, Fiber and Protein
